design in Greek is σχέδιο, σχεδιάζω — design means a plan showing how something should look, function, or be built.

What does "design" mean?
-
noun A plan showing how something should look, function, or be built.
"The architect presented her design for the new library."
-
verb To plan and work out the details of something before it is made.
"She designs websites for small businesses."
-
noun A decorative pattern.
"The wallpaper had a floral design."
